Comfort Level: What to Consider

Convenience is subjective, but there are a number of factors that can assist you determine how comfy a sofa will be:

  1. Seat Depth and Height: A much deeper seat might provide more room to lounge, while a shallower one may be better for upright sitting.
  2. Cushion Fill: Sofas can be filled with foam, plume, or a combination. Foam uses firmness, whereas plumes offer a plush feel.
  3. Back Support: Look for sofas that offer appropriate lumbar assistance; this can be a game-changer for long periods of sitting.
  4. Armrest Height: The height and shape of the arms can affect how comfy you are while relaxing or seeing television.

Shopping Tips

When it concerns purchasing a comfy couch, think about the following suggestions to make the procedure easier:

  • Measure Your Space: Before you go shopping, determine the area where the sofa will go. Consider not just the length and width however likewise the height, particularly if you have low ceilings.
  • Test It Out: Sit on the sofa before purchasing. Spend a long time lounging to evaluate convenience properly.
  • Examine Reviews: Online reviews can offer insights into the sofa's long-lasting durability and convenience levels.
  • Consider Delivery and Returns: Look into the store's shipment options and return policy, particularly if you're purchasing online.

FAQs

1. What size sofa do I require for my area?

The size of the sofa depends on the dimensions of your living space. Generally, you desire to enable a minimum of 30 inches of strolling space in between the sofa and other furnishings. Procedure the location where you plan to put the sofa and consider both length and depth.

2. How can I maintain my sofa?

Maintenance differs by product but typically includes routine vacuuming, spot cleaning spots right away, and using suitable cleansing items recommended for the specific fabric.

3. What's the typical life-span of a sofa?

A well-maintained sofa can last anywhere from 7 to 15 years, depending on the quality of products and building and construction.
